Honesdale Borough officials hosted the initial community meeting of agencies, churches, and non-profit organizations to discuss homelessness in the Borough. Those attending shared efforts and programs that currently exist and suggested both short term and long term goals and objectives. Subsequent meetings will formalize the mission of the group and include planning fundraising including grant writing and direct communication. The meeting was conducted at the Park Street Complex, Honesdale on April 14, 2026.

The Honesdale Borough Council will conduct a work session Monday April 13,2026 at 6 PM, in Borough Hall, 958 Main Street, Honesdale, PA, for the purpose of discussing the recommendations by the Pennsylvania Economy League regarding the STMP program grant and anything else placed upon the agenda.

N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that the Honesdale Borough Uniform Construction Code Board shall hold the Hearing in the below referenced matter on Wednesday, April 29, 2026, at 9:00 A.M. at Honesdale Borough Hall, 958 Main Street, Honesdale, Pa, 18431.

The appeal of Leonard Schwartz challenging the Borough’s Notice of Violation. Specifically, Mr. Schwartz asserts in his appeal that “[t]he alleged violation is incorrect. No electrical outlets were ever under water. The Violation is improper.”

A copy of said Application(s) is available at the Honesdale Borough Hall for public review and inspection during normal business hours. This hearing was originally set for February 11, 2026, but was continued.

Honesdale Borough officials wish to share a few of the details about the ongoing stormwater project Vine/Terrace /4th Street Stormwater Project:

In the past weeks, the Borough’s Contractor, Pioneer Construction has been hard at work to implement the repair and upgrades to the stormwater system in the area. The project is intended to be a permanent solution for the recent flooding problems experienced at the Vine Street/Commercial Street/Terrace Street area. In the coming week, there will be Terrace Street Lane closures during the day on Monday March 30, and beginning Tuesday night March 31, Terrace Street will be fully closed in this area for overnight work from 9 pm to 6 am, with a detour in place.
Borough officials appreciate the continued patience and cooperation of area residents during this construction.
